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ade (1989)

Wikipedia

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ade is a 1989 American action-adventure film directed by Steven Spielberg, from a story co-written by executive producer George Lucas. It is the third installment in the Indiana Jones franchise. Harrison Ford reprises the title role, while his father is portrayed by Sean Connery. Other cast members featured include Alison Doody, Denholm Elliott, Julian Glover, River Phoenix, and John Rhys-Davies. In the film, set largely in 1938, Indiana searches for his father, a Holy Grail scholar, who has been kidnapped by Nazis.

Even though this isn’t the first movie with a religious context, it is the one that gets the most personal. Indiana is forced to confront his own faith as he pursues the Holy Grail against the Nazis.

Now that I’m into the third movie I can see how each pursues a relic of religious context: the Ark of the Covenant, Shiva’s Sankara Stones, and the Holy Grail. I find that supremely interesting.

I also really liked that we got to see a young Indy (River Phoenix), whom I once had a crush on, and his father (Sean Connery). It turns it into a fun family flick!
